How to Validate Integer Input in JavaScript

Whether you need to check for integers to ensure data consistency or prompt users with accurate error messages, JavaScript provides several methods to validate integer inputs.

One common approach involves using the parseInt() function. However, this method alone may not suffice if you want to handle scenarios such as strings that could potentially be parsed as integers.

Robust Integer Validation Function

The following function combines multiple checks to ensure robust integer validation:

function isInt(value) {
  return !isNaN(value) &&
         parseInt(Number(value)) == value &&
         !isNaN(parseInt(value, 10));
}
Copy after login

This function can handle both numeric strings and primitive numbers, ensuring accurate validation.

Bitwise Operators for Enhanced Performance

If performance is a priority, you can utilize bitwise operators for efficient integer checks:

function isInt(value) {
  var x = parseFloat(value);
  return !isNaN(value) && (x | 0) === x;
}
Copy after login

This method uses the bitwise OR operator (|) to coerce the input into an integer. If the result matches the original value, the input is an integer.

Additional Validation Options

Here are a few more approaches for integer validation:

  • Short-circuiting with parseFloat():
function isInt(value) {
  if (isNaN(value)) return false;
  var x = parseFloat(value);
  return (x | 0) === x;
}
Copy after login
  • NaN Coercion:
function isInt(value) {
  return !isNaN(value) && parseInt(value, 10) == value;
}
Copy after login
  • Truthy 0 Check:
function isInt(value) {
  return !isNaN(value) && parseInt(value, 10) && (parseInt(value, 10) | 0) === parseInt(value, 10);
}
Copy after login

Choosing the right validation method depends on the specific requirements and performance considerations of your application.
